// Scilab code Exa1.11.1 : To find the speed, mass and mass number of the ion which is accelerated in a mass spectrograph : Page 40 (2011) V = 1000; // Potential difference, volts R = 0.122; // Radius of the circular path, m B = 1500e-04; // Magnetic field, tesla e = 1.602e-019; // Charge of the electron, C amu = 1.673e-027; // Atomic mass unit, kg v = (2*V)/(R*B); // Speed of the ion, m/s M = 2*e*V/v^2; // Mass of the ion, kg A = M/amu; // Mass number printf("\n Speed > %5.3e m/s \n Mass > %5.3e kg \n Mass number > %5.2f ",v, M, A); // Result // // Speed > 1.093e+005 m/s // Mass > 2.682e-026 kg // Mass number > 16.03
